Comprehending the Bail Bond Process
The lawful system can typically be complex, understanding the bail bond procedure is essential for those navigating it. When an individual is apprehended, a judge typically establishes a bond amount based on the extent of the violation and the offender's background. Bail offers as a financial guarantee that the charged will certainly return for court looks. If the defendant can not afford the Bail, they may seek the solutions of a bail bond representative.
The representative bills a non-refundable cost, usually around 10% of the Bail quantity, and provides the needed funds to the court. In return, the representative may require collateral, such as property or valuables, to mitigate their threat. Upon the offender's court look, the Bail is launched, however failing to appear can result in losing the collateral and additional charges. Comprehending this process helps individuals make informed decisions during a difficult time.

Economic Implications of Monetary Bail
Monetary Bail has substantial financial effects for individuals and the broader area. It can develop considerable monetary problems for accuseds and their households, particularly if they do not have adequate sources. For lots of, protecting Bail might include high passion loans or utilizing savings, which can bring about financial stress and potential debt. This economic pressure can negatively affect employment, as individuals may shed work because of incarceration or the anxiety of lawful procedures.
In addition, the dependence on monetary Bail can add to wider social problems. Areas may experience enhanced poverty line as families draw away funds from vital needs to cover Bail expenses. Additionally, the financial variations aggravated by monetary Bail can perpetuate cycles of inequality, as those with fewer resources face higher difficulties in navigating the lawful system. On the whole, the economic effects of financial Bail extend beyond private instances, influencing area stability and economic health and wellness.
Difficulties Faced by At Risk Populaces in Protecting Bail
Protecting Bail offers substantial challenges for at risk populations, specifically those from low-income histories. Several people in these groups do not have the monetary resources to pay Bail amounts, which can cause long term incarceration, even for small offenses. This scenario intensifies existing socioeconomic differences, as individuals continue to be incapable to care or work for their family members while apprehended. In addition, standard bail bond solutions commonly need security or charges that are unattainable for low-income people, further restricting their options.
Furthermore, the preconception linked with arrest can prevent neighborhood assistance, leaving these individuals separated. Language barriers and absence of access to legal advice can complicate their understanding of the Bail procedure. Consequently, numerous susceptible people locate themselves trapped in a cycle of hardship and legal complication, highlighting the immediate demand for systemic changes to address these inequities in the Bail system.

Just How Do Bail Bond Representatives Identify the Cost of Their Services?
Bail bond agents commonly identify their solution costs based on the complete Bail amount, regional regulations, the offender's risk analysis, and the company's functional expenses, commonly charging a portion of the Bail set by the court.
What Happens if a Defendant Does Not Appear in Court?
A bench warrant might be provided for their arrest if an offender stops working to appear in court. Additionally, any kind of Bail uploaded can be surrendered, causing financial loss for the bail bond agent and the accused.

Are There Alternatives to Traditional Bail Bonds?
Alternatives to traditional Bail bonds include release on recognizance, pretrial find out this here services programs, and residential property bonds. These options objective to ensure accuseds appear in court while reducing monetary problems and advertising fairer legal processes for all entailed.

Just How Do Bail Bonds Effect Credit Report?
Bail bonds do not straight influence credit rating, as they are not reported to credit report bureaus. However, failure to pay off a bail bond can lead to collections, which might adversely impact an individual's credit score.
